North America Contraceptive Implant Market

 

North America contraceptive implant market refers to the segment of the healthcare industry dedicated to the development, production, and distribution of contraceptive implants within the geographical region of North America. These implants are hormonal contraceptives inserted under the skin, providing long-term contraception to women.

Most Frequently Asked Questions Related to Market

Contraceptive implants offer long-lasting protection, require minimal maintenance, have a quick return to fertility after removal, and provide a discreet, effective option with fewer user errors compared to other methods.
Yes, contraceptive implants are reversible; they can be removed at any time, allowing for the return of fertility.
Contraceptive implants provide protection for up to three to five years, depending on the type of implant used.
